The module is designed to sit at the lowest point of your wetland filter to efficiently collect and remove accumulated sediment. By capturing debris before it breaks down, it helps maintain clearer water and a healthier pond ecosystem.
Yes, the Half Centipede Module is designed for versatility and works with both earth-bottom and lined ponds. It is specifically engineered to integrate with the Aquascape Large Snorkel Vault and can be retrofitted into most existing wetland filter systems.
By concentrating sediment in a specific, accessible location, the module prevents debris from spreading throughout your filter bed. This makes cleaning significantly faster and reduces the frequency at which you need to perform deep maintenance on your wetland filter.
The module measures 32 inches in length, 12 inches in width, and 10.5 inches in height, including the end cap. You should ensure you have adequate space at the base of your filter vault to accommodate these dimensions during installation.
The modular design is intended for straightforward installation, but because it is a retrofit, you will need to clear the area at the bottom of your filter vault first. No complex electrical or plumbing work is required, as it functions as a passive collection component within the filter system.
